Key Responsibilities
- Maintain excellent in-stock rates for owned category and/or region
- Execute inventory strategies to optimize sales, turns, and inventory health
- Monitor, analyze, and own key performance indicators such as in-stock rate, procurement lead time (PLT), fill rate, forecast accuracy, and turns
- Forecast and manage efficient inbound and outbound inventory flows, including purchasing and removing unproductive inventory
- Drive root cause analysis and reporting on operational issues, develop action plans, and project manage improvements while managing multiple competing priorities
- Collaborate with internal teams to drive tools and process improvements, emphasizing automation of manual tasks
